Justification
EOO 3467 km², known from at least 11 locations, and declining predominantly in the southern parts of its range due to ongoing habitat loss. Northern subpopulations are protected within the Cederberg Wilderness Area and not threatened.

Description
Well-drained sandy soils, predominantly on flats in sandstone, quartzite and alluvial fynbos.
Threats
Subpopulations on alluvial sandy flats in the Koue Bokkeveld and west of Touwsrivier are threatened by ongoing habitat loss to crop cultivation. Remaining vegetation on the flats west of Touwsrivier is also severely degraded due to overgrazing, and it is not certain whether this species survives in this area, where it was last recorded in 1924. In valleys in the Koue Bokkeveld, some subpopulations may also have been lost to dam construction.
Population

Ixia contorta has a narrow distribution range on the arid eastern margin of the fynbos biome, which remains botanically still relatively poorly explored. It is known from at least 11 locations, but it is highly likely that more exist. At least half of known subpopulations are threatened by habitat loss.
